Italian word

critica

criticism; also a review (of a book, film, etc.)

Looks like

critique

a detailed analysis and assessment

⚠️ The trap

Critica is close to critique/criticism. However in Italian 'la critica' (with article) often refers collectively to critics or the critical establishment — a nuance English learners often miss.

To say "a detailed analysis and assessment" in Italian:

critica (overlaps, but register differs)

"critica" in English means:

criticism; also a review (of a book, film, etc.)

Example

"La critica ha apprezzato il suo nuovo romanzo."

"The critics appreciated his new novel."
